Subject: NRC Region I Special Team Inspection Report No. 50-317/90-24

(September 4 to 7, 1990)

.

This report transmits the findings of the Special Team Inspection conducted at

the Calvert Cliff s Nuclear Power Plant, Unit 1. At the conclusion of the t

inspection, these findings were discussed with'Mr. Denton of your staff. This

inspection was conducted by a team led by Mr. R. Summers of this office and

included representatives of .the Office of Nuclear Reactor Regulation and the

Office for Analysis and Evaluation of Operational Data. The team performed an

in-depth review of the reactor vessel water level anomaly that occurred while

draining the reactor coolant system on August 30, 1990.

'

The creas examined during this special inspection are- described in the NRC

Region I Inspectien Report which is enclosed with this. letter. Within these i

areas, the inspection consisted of selective examination of procedures, inter- ,

views with personnel, and observations by the inspectors of your own investi-

gation of the event. ,

Within the scope of the inspection, no violations were observed; however, cer-

'

tain of your activities were specifically noted by the team as being concerns.

The concerns were: (1) venting an unknown gas directly to containment without ,

adequate radiological or chemical hazards support; (2) use of journeyman know-

'

ledge to complete the venting of the gas without procedures; and-(3) lack of  ;

operator knowledge regarding a temporary modification on: the Reactor Vessel .

Level Monitoring System.

We are interested in the manner in which you plan to address these concerns as l

.well as any additional actions you have taken or plan to _take as a result of

your own investigation. Therefore, '.te would like you to respond to this letter

within 30 days addressing these matters. .
